FAQs
Could my roof be causing attic mold?
Improper ventilation on a 4/12 pitch roof is a common culprit. The 2022 California Residential Code mandates a balanced system of intake and exhaust to expel hot, moist air. An imbalanced system traps humidity in the attic, leading to mold growth on sheathing and rafters, which compromises indoor air quality and can rot the roof deck from the inside out.

Are regular shingles strong enough for our winds?
Beaumont's 110 mph Ultimate Design Wind Speed zone requires specific installation techniques. For peak season atmospheric river events, Class 4 impact-resistant shingles are a financial necessity, not just an upgrade. They are tested to withstand hail and wind-driven debris, which minimizes storm damage claims and helps maintain your home's insurability and value.
Should I install solar shingles or a traditional roof with panels?
The choice hinges on timing and NEM 3.0 economics. A new architectural asphalt shingle roof with integrated mounting points is the most cost-effective base for future panel add-ons, preserving the 30% federal tax credit for the solar system. In 2026, integrated solar shingles offer a streamlined look but often at a higher initial cost and with less flexibility for future roof component replacement.
My roof looks fine from the ground. Do I still need an inspection?
A visual assessment misses critical subsurface issues. Standard diagnostic procedures now combine aerial imagery with manual moisture mapping to identify trapped moisture within the shingle layers and OSB decking. This reveals failing areas long before leaks become visible inside, allowing for planned, budgeted replacement instead of emergency repairs.
My homeowner's insurance premium in Beaumont keeps climbing. Can my roof help?
Yes, the current 18% premium trend is directly influenced by storm risk. Upgrading to an IBHS FORTIFIED Home standard roof is a voluntary measure that insurance companies recognize with significant discounts. This system reinforces the roof deck attachment, sealing, and impact resistance, which lowers the insurer's risk profile for your home and results in a lower annual bill.
What are the current code requirements for a roof replacement?
The City of Beaumont Building and Safety Department enforces the 2022 California Residential Code. This requires a contractor with an active C-39 license from the CSLB to pull a permit. Key 2026 specifications include ice and water shield in valleys and at eaves, and specific flashing offsets at walls and penetrations to prevent water intrusion under high-wind pressure.
